1 前言上一篇介绍了用C++如何将一幅彩色图像和灰度图像进行反色处理,本篇接着用python来做同样的事情。图像反转,其目的就是增强图像的暗区中白色或灰色的细节,特别是原图中的阴影黑色区域。原理就是用值255减去原来像素点上的像素值,比如用255(白色)-0(黑色)得到的是255(白色)。2 相关概念像素:像素是图像的最小单位。每一幅图像都是由M行N列的像素组成的,其中每一个像素都存储一个像素值。
OpenCV之Python学习笔记 一直都在用Python+OpenCV做一些算法的原型。本来想留下发布一些文章的,可是整理一下就有点无奈了,都是写零散不成系统的小片段。现在看到一本国外的新书《OpenCV Computer Vision with Python》,于是就看一遍,顺便把自己掌握的东西整合一下,写成学习笔记了。更需要的朋友参考。 阅读须知:   &nb
反向投影是计算像素和直方图模型中像素吻合度的一种方法。例如有肤色的直方图,可以使用反向投影在图像中寻找肤色区域,用来做这种寻找操作的函数有两种形式,一个是为稠密数组而设计的,另一个为稀疏数组设计的。和cv::calcHist()类似,反向投影从输入图像的指定通道中计算出一个向量。不同之处在于cv::calcHist()在向直方图中记录累计值,反向投影从输入的直方图中读取当前像素对应的计数值作为结果
文章目录0.前言1.提取出图片的像素2.图片的亮度和对比度的调节1.亮度和对比度和像素值之间的关系2.代码实现3.其他的操作1.图片反相3.图片混合 0.前言opencv对像素的操作有两种,一种是对单个单个的像素进行操作(点操作),一种是对一片区域的像素进行操作。他们可以分别用于实现不同的效果最近主要学了一部分的点操作和一些通过点操作能实现的效果首先便是要能取出一个图片的所有的像素值1.提取出图
初中的物理我们都学过小孔成像物体的光线通过一个小孔,会倒映到黑盒中后方的投影版上,然后就可以在投影版上看到图像的倒影了。这个技术很好地被应用在了照片上。开始的科学家们想到,既然通过小孔成像能把影像投射到投影板上,那么我如果开发一种感光材料放在投影板上,感光材料通过光的影响,会发生化学变化,然后当光关闭的时候,刚才投射在感光材料上的影像(其实就是光)就有短暂的记忆功能,靠着这个记忆功能,就可以把影像
转载 2024-06-12 21:10:32
90阅读
操作图像像素图像操作读写图像读写像素修改像素值Vec3b与Vec3F代码中函数简介自定义函数opencv自带函数代码实现效果具体代码实现 图像操作读写图像imread 可以指定加载为灰度或者RGB图像Imwrite 保存图像文件,类型由扩展名决定读写像素读一个GRAY像素点的像素值(CV_8UC1) Scalar intensity = img.at(y, x); 或者 Scalar inten
# 如何在Android中实现Bitmap颜色反相 在Android开发中,很多时候我们需要处理图片,例如实现颜色反相的效果。本文将为刚入行的小白详细讲解如何在Android中实现Bitmap颜色反相,并通过清晰的步骤和示例代码帮助您更好地理解整个过程。 ## 流程概述 为了实现Bitmap的颜色反相,我们将按照以下步骤进行操作: | 步骤 | 描述
原创 10月前
97阅读
焦距范围常识首先镜头分全画幅镜头和残幅镜头(4/3)镜头焦距范围如下:10-17mm为超广角-拍摄风景,尤其是大场景,比如草原、沙漠、大海;17-35mm广角-风景、人文,尤其是适合旅行拍摄 ;35-135mm中焦-人文、人像。这个焦段里面85mm焦段尤其是被推崇为拍人像最佳的焦段,经常可以看见把85mm F1.8这样的镜头叫做人像头;50mm-这个焦段据说最符合人眼看出去的视角所...
原创 2021-08-18 11:51:29
223阅读
这个顾名思义,对图像做减法。 Image_new=1-Image_old; 原图: 反相
PS
转载 2014-05-01 15:39:00
217阅读
2评论
# Python中使用cv2实现图像反相 在图像处理中,图像反相是一种常见的操作,可以通过反相来改变图像的明暗对比度,使得图像更加饱满和生动。在Python中,可以利用OpenCV库(cv2)来实现图像反相功能。本文将介绍如何使用cv2库来对图像进行反相处理,并提供相应的代码示例。 ## 什么是图像反相? 图像反相是指将图像中每个像素的灰度值取反,即255减去当前像素的灰度值。这样可以实现黑
原创 2024-03-05 03:36:38
299阅读
数码单反相机的技术细节在这篇文章中,我们将说明数码单反相机DSLR(Digital Single 或单反相机——数码单反
原创 2022-12-17 19:31:27
131阅读
一、相机优势1、图像感应器面积数码单反相机与小型数码相机相比较,主要的
原创 2023-04-04 10:52:01
386阅读
【健康休闲】单反相机成像原理 简单说: 当你按下快门时,14 反光板就会起来,像就成在后面的底片CCD或者CMOS上。 【转载】 单反就是指单镜头反光,即SLR(Single Lens Reflex),这是当今最流行的取景系统,大多数35mm照相机都采用这种取景器。在这种系统中,反光镜和棱镜的独到设计使得摄影者可以从取景器中直接观察到通过镜头的影像。因此,可以准确地看见胶片即将“看见
转载 精选 2012-02-28 18:23:38
4432阅读
# Python二值化图片反相的科普文章 在图像处理中,二值化是将图像转换为只有两个颜色值的过程,通常是黑与白。这种处理在图像分析和计算机视觉中具有广泛的应用,比如在OCR(光学字符识别)中。除此之外,我们经常需要对二值化后的图像进行反相(也称取反),即将黑色部分变为白色,白色部分变为黑色。本文将介绍如何使用Python进行二值化和反相处理,并提供相应的代码示例。 ## 一、安装依赖 首先,
原创 2024-09-02 05:28:46
74阅读
第一大类:光圈在相机中,光圈用“F+数字”的形式表示,方框内显示的F3.5就是光圈。F后面的数字越大,表示光圈越小;F后面的数字越小,表示光圈越大。▍光圈对照片的影响光圈越大,虚化越严重,景深越浅;光圈越小,虚化越轻微,景深越深。▍如何选择合适的光圈①大光圈容易突出主体,适合拍花卉,人物特写等;②小光圈适合拍风景类的题材。▍光圈如何设置①在AV档(光圈优先模式)的时候,直接转动机身顶部的主拨盘就可
# Python调用单反相机的流程和实现指南 在如今的数字时代,许多爱好摄影的人都希望能通过编程来控制他们的单反相机,进行更高级的拍摄操作。本文将教你如何使用Python调用单反相机的基本步骤,适合刚入行的小白。 ## 整体流程 以下是调用单反相机的主要步骤: | 步骤 | 内容 | 描述
原创 2024-09-22 04:13:25
251阅读
  我们都知道,网站的反相链接数量,决定了网站的Link Popularity——当然,反相链接的质量也同样重要——从而最终影响到网站在搜索引擎中的排名。因此,在网站优化过程中,随时掌握有哪些网站、有多少网站建立了指向我们网站的链接是非常重要的,这是对网站优化效果进行阶段性分析以求更有针对性改进的基础数据,另外,随时掌握竞争网站的链接情况对于实现搜索引擎最佳化同样也是极为重要的。那么,如何得到网站
转载 精选 2006-10-30 23:02:14
711阅读
前言  以前特别羡慕那些会拍照的同学,更羡慕有一个会拍照的男盆友,不过我既不会拍照又没有一个会拍照的boyfriend,只有一群会批图的女盆友,一次偶然的机会让我进入了小记者团,进入这个团队之后自然而然就多了一些外出跟拍的机会,还有幸接触到了李老师的单反相
原创 2022-02-23 15:51:25
208阅读
# Python OpenCV灰度图反相实现指南 ## 引言 在图像处理领域,灰度图反相是一种常见的操作,它将图像中的每个像素值反转,从而创建一个与原图颜色完全相反的图像。本文将指导初学者如何使用Python和OpenCV库来实现灰度图的反相。 ## 准备工作 在开始之前,请确保你已经安装了Python和OpenCV库。如果尚未安装OpenCV,可以通过以下命令安装: ```bash pip
原创 2024-07-25 03:44:50
166阅读
# 使用Python实现图像反相的完整指南 在数字图像处理中,反相是一种简单而有效的技术,其基本原理是获取图像每个像素的反向颜色。例如,对于RGB颜色模型,黑色(0,0,0)会反转为白色(255,255,255),红色(255,0,0)会反转为青色(0,255,255)等。这里我们将探索如何使用Python中的`PIL`库(即Pillow)和`numpy`库来实现图像反相,并解决一些实际问题,比
原创 10月前
180阅读
  • 1
  • 2
  • 3
  • 4
  • 5